Erpf, Armand Grover was born on December 8, 1897 in New York City. Son of Bartholomew and Cornelia (von Greiner) Erpf.
Bachelor of Science, Columbia, 1917. Doctor of Humane Letters, Catholic U. American, Doctor of Laws, Manhattan College.
Assistant secretary Suffern Company of New York, and assistant manager Suffern Company of Brazil, 1917-1919. Officer and part owner Civil Engineer Erpf & Company, brokers, 1919-1923. Made survey of textile enterprise in Saxony, Germany, 1923-1924.
Statistician, later officer, director and part owner Cornell, Linder & Company, Incorporated., New York City, 1924-1933.
Director statistical and research departments and subsequently, investment advisory department Loeb, Rhoades & Company, 1933-1936, general partner, from 1936. Chairman of the executive committee, director Crowell Collier & Macmillan, Incorporated.
Chairman Aneid Equities. Member of board directors Adela Investment Company, South America, General Instrument Corporation, Adela Investment Company, South America, Macmillan Company, Jefferson Insurance Company, Chris-Craft Industries, Incorporated., Dorr-Oliver, Incorporated., Jersey External Trust, Stein, Roe & Farnham International Fund.
Chairman council Graduate School of Business, Columbia University.
Chairman, Board Of Directors Arkville Erpf Fund. Board of Governors New York Cultural Center. Trustee Chamber Music Society Lincoln Center.
Commissioned lieutenant colonel, United States Army, 1942.
Promoted colonel, 1944. Appointed to General Staff Corps, 1944.
Assigned Office of Commanding General headquarters A.S.F., Washington, 1942-1945. Duty with headquarters United States Army Forces, Western Pacific, and with commanding general United States Air Force, China Theater, 1945-1946.
Member Council on Foreign Relations, Incorporated., Affiliated Business. Clubs: Art Collectors, Economic, Wall Saint
Married Sue Stuart Mortimore, April. Children: Cornelia, Armand.
